Potential Trump-Era Environmental & Climate Policy Reversals

A Detailed Review of Potential Trump-Era Reversals

Meteorology Matters analyzes the key environmental actions taken by the Biden administration, focusing on the potential challenges and ease with which President Trump may attempt to reverse them.

Key Themes:

  • Sweeping Scope: Biden's environmental agenda is characterized by its breadth and depth, impacting various sectors and aiming for long-term sustainability. This makes complete dismantling difficult.
  • Legal and Scientific Foundation: Many of Biden's policies are rooted in robust scientific evidence and legal frameworks, making them resistant to arbitrary rollbacks.
  • Economic and Political Considerations: While Trump champions deregulation for economic growth, some of Biden's policies enjoy industry support (like methane regulation) or face international pressure (like EV production).Key Areas of Focus and Potential for Reversal:

1. Climate Change and Air Pollution

  • Greenhouse Gas Standards for Vehicles: Reversing these standards could be challenging due to industry investments in EV production to comply with global regulations. Difficulty: Medium
  • Greenhouse Gas Standards for Power Plants: Trump's promise to "terminate" the power plant rule will likely face legal challenges similar to those faced during his first term. Difficulty: Medium
  • Limits on Mercury and Air Toxics from Coal Plants: Reversing strengthened limits will likely be met with lawsuits from civil rights and environmental groups. Difficulty: Medium
  • Phaseout of Climate Super-Pollutants (HFCs): Reversing the HFC phase-down, authorized by a bipartisan bill, would require new legislation from Congress. Difficulty: Difficult

2. Drilling and Extraction

  • Limits on Methane from Drilling Operations: Trump may face pressure from the oil industry, which supports methane regulation, to retain this rule. Difficulty: Medium
  • Fee on Methane from Oil and Gas Facilities: Repealing these fees, authorized by the Inflation Reduction Act, would likely require new legislation. Difficulty: Difficult
  • Protections for D1 lands in Alaska: Trump's previous attempts to revoke protections for D1 lands faced hurdles, and reversing this policy could encounter similar challenges. Difficulty: Medium

3. Chemical Safety

  • Listing of PFAS under the Superfund law: This designation has already drawn legal challenges from industry groups and could face further legal hurdles if reversed. Difficulty: Medium
  • Removal of All Lead Pipes: The Safe Drinking Water Act's provisions make weakening existing health protections difficult, potentially leading to legal challenges. Difficulty: Medium
  • Complete Ban on Asbestos: Trump's previous failures to regulate asbestos were deemed "arbitrary and capricious" by a federal court, making a reversal difficult. Difficulty: Medium

4. Conservation

  • Expansion of National Monuments: Trump's previous downsizing of national monuments sparked legal battles. Repealing expansions faces similar resistance and potential Supreme Court involvement. Difficulty: Easy
  • Protection of Boundary Waters: Reversing the mining ban would face opposition from conservationists and potentially impact local water quality, leading to legal challenges. Difficulty: Medium (Rating by Washington Post)
